> On 2018/10/6 17:09, Hou Tao wrote:
> > When an invalid mount option is passed to jffs2, jffs2_parse_options()
> > will fail and jffs2_sb_info will be freed, but then jffs2_sb_info will
> > be used (use-after-free) and freeed (double-free) in jffs2_kill_sb().
> >
> > Fix it by removing the buggy invocation of kfree() when getting invalid
> > mount options.
